Asked & answered.

The things candidates actually want to know, answered honestly.

Are hours really guaranteed? Or is it a zero-hours thing with extra steps?
Actually guaranteed. Your weekly hours are locked into your contract — not a "minimum of 8 hours" contract that quietly becomes 4. If we can't give you your contracted hours in a week, we still pay them. No zero-hours, no mystery shifts, no games.
What's the latest I'd ever finish?
11pm, maximum. That's the absolute latest across every role in the company. Most shifts finish earlier. We're a lunch-focused business, not a late-night operation — that's the whole point of the brand, and it shapes everyone's schedule.
How does progression actually work?
Every role has a defined next step with defined criteria. Typically after 3 months of consistent performance at current level, a manager signs off the step up. It's written down, it's merit-based, and it's not political. We also promote across tracks — FOH into kitchen or vice versa — if that's what you want.
I'm a student — can I actually do 6–7 hours a week and no more?
Yes. The Rush Team Member role is designed exactly for that. Mon/Tue/Wed evenings only, 6–8:30pm, £15/hr. It's a real job with real hours — just small, consistent, and by design. Apply to that role specifically, not to Team Member in Training.
Do I need experience?
For Team Member in Training, Kitchen Porter, and Kitchen Prep — no. We train you properly. For Team Member, Kitchen Specialist, and Kitchen Supervisor — yes, some relevant hospitality or kitchen experience is required. Role descriptions spell out exactly what we're looking for.
What if I apply for the wrong role?
Not a problem. If your application is a better fit for a different role, we'll tell you and ask if you want to be considered for it instead. Nobody's trying to catch you out.
How long before I hear back?
We aim to respond to every application within 5 working days. Even if it's a no, you hear back — because ghosting is awful and we don't do it.
Right to work in the UK?
Required for all roles. We'll check documents at interview stage — standard for UK hospitality. If you're on a student visa with the right working hours, the Rush Team Member role is worth a look.
